What are worm gear units?
Worm gears combine a screw-like component with a gear wheel to provide compact speed reduction. By transferring torque and redirecting motion within a limited space, the design supports equipment that needs a compact, controlled drive arrangement.
Why NORD Flexbloc Replacements Depend on the Drive Setup
NORD replacement parts should be reviewed against the existing drive setup before a replacement is selected. Even within the same Flexbloc family, installed equipment details affect which unit fits and operates as required.
Details used to match a NORD Flexbloc replacement in Raleigh, NC, include:
- Gear ratio: The gear ratio affects equipment speed, torque, and timing after installation. A replacement that does not match the required reduction can change how the machine moves once it is back in service.
- Shaft or bore style: The replacement has to connect cleanly to the existing drive components. Hollow bore, solid shaft, and output shaft details can all affect whether the unit fits the installed setup.
- Mounting configuration: The mounting arrangement affects whether the unit fits without avoidable equipment changes. Foot, flange, and mounting-position details have to align with the reducer configuration used by the installed equipment.
- Motor input: Motor input details help determine how the replacement connects to the existing drive, including setups built around a C-Face motor or NORD brakemotor already installed. Overlooking the motor connection may delay installation once the replacement arrives.
- Operating load: The unit also has to support the duty cycle and service conditions surrounding the drive. Even a physically compatible replacement still has to perform under the machine’s operating load.
A Flexbloc product name provides a starting point, but the replacement decision should begin with the installed drive setup. The selected unit must fit the machine and support its operation after the equipment returns to service.
How NORD Flexbloc Gear Unit Problems Develop
A NORD Flexbloc gear unit in Raleigh, NC, does not have to stop working completely to show signs of trouble. Changes in operation may accompany visible leakage, excess heat, or wear that places more stress on the drive system.
Warning signs may include:
Unusual noise or vibration from the drive
New sound or movement during operation can point to internal wear, alignment issues, bearing problems, or a drive setup that is no longer running cleanly.
- Humming that is new or louder around the unit
- Increased vibration during loaded operation
- Starts or stops that no longer feel smooth
The unit may remain in service while these symptoms grow more severe and the underlying problem remains difficult to see.
Leaks from the Flexbloc housing
Oil around the unit housing can point to worn seals, gasket issues, overfilled lubrication, heat, or internal pressure that needs to be checked before a replacement is ordered.
The equipment may remain online while an active leak changes lubrication conditions and raises contamination risk as the unit moves closer to a more disruptive service problem.
Operating temperatures that rise unexpectedly
A warm gear unit does not automatically indicate trouble. Concern rises when the temperature changes unexpectedly or accompanies a difference in how the equipment sounds, moves, or performs.
- Heat increases beyond what is normal for the application
- Heat rises faster or stays longer under heavier load
- The unit runs hotter while also leaking or moving differently
Unexpected heat should be considered alongside the machine’s workload and operating pattern. Those conditions help determine what the replacement unit will need to handle in service.
Loss of torque or inconsistent movement
The equipment may slow down as the operating load increases. Reduced torque may also affect the consistent movement required by hoists, transfer systems, and other driven equipment.
Restoring consistent motion depends on a replacement that matches the complete drive arrangement. The unit has to preserve equipment speed and torque while connecting properly to the components already in place.
Different symptoms may lead to different replacement decisions. Reviewing the Flexbloc unit within the surrounding drive system helps determine whether to replace it directly or address another component first.

Replacement Options for NORD Flexbloc Units
A Flexbloc replacement review in Raleigh, NC, may extend beyond the individual gear unit. Depending on the drive arrangement, the replacement path may involve the gear unit by itself or an assembly that includes the motor. Connected brake components and installation accessories may also need review.
NORD SK072.1-19.2 Helical Gearmotor Assembly
Full NORD gearmotor assemblies
A complete gearmotor assembly may be the better replacement path when the reducer, motor, ratio, and mounting details were selected to work together. A single-component replacement may not connect or perform correctly without matching the original assembly details.
NORD Flexbloc reducer replacements
The existing Flexbloc reducer may provide the basis for direct replacement if the surrounding equipment remains unchanged. Identifying its reduction ratio, mounting setup, and output connection helps confirm the match.
NORD 19011912 5 NM Complete Brake Assembly
Braking parts and complete assemblies
Brake components may be part of the replacement path when a Flexbloc unit supports lifting or holding equipment. A compatible reducer alone may not restore the required behavior if the braking components are overlooked.
Motor, brakemotor, and input details
The installed motor arrangement remains part of the Flexbloc replacement match. Brakemotor needs and motor-input style may point to different assemblies or connected parts. Available horsepower, voltage, and mounting information help confirm the replacement.
Shaft, bore, and mounting accessories
Hollow-bore details, solid shaft kits, flange or foot mounting, output shaft requirements, and accessory kits can determine whether the replacement fits the existing machine layout without avoidable field changes.
The goal is to narrow the replacement path before an order is placed, so the selected NORD part or assembly matches the equipment instead of only matching a general product category.
